aboutsummaryrefslogtreecommitdiffstats
path: root/main
diff options
context:
space:
mode:
authorNatanael Copa <ncopa@alpinelinux.org>2013-07-12 06:29:47 +0000
committerNatanael Copa <ncopa@alpinelinux.org>2013-07-12 06:36:34 +0000
commitb522c17a47a568f9d5a162c796c58ca81c09f39b (patch)
treee51ec0fd92f1ab0f5d57a415df66949c1f880c75 /main
parentedac16d0ba026e4bebc9fa6cdd65137ddd045fa7 (diff)
downloadaports-b522c17a47a568f9d5a162c796c58ca81c09f39b.tar.bz2
aports-b522c17a47a568f9d5a162c796c58ca81c09f39b.tar.xz
main/gtk-vnc: switch to gtk3
Diffstat (limited to 'main')
-rw-r--r--main/gtk-vnc/APKBUILD24
1 files changed, 8 insertions, 16 deletions
diff --git a/main/gtk-vnc/APKBUILD b/main/gtk-vnc/APKBUILD
index f3dc4bff2d..e3c1e32807 100644
--- a/main/gtk-vnc/APKBUILD
+++ b/main/gtk-vnc/APKBUILD
@@ -1,25 +1,24 @@
#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
pkgname=gtk-vnc
pkgver=0.5.2
-pkgrel=1
+pkgrel=2
pkgdesc="A VNC viewer widget for GTK"
url="http://live.gnome.org/gtk-vnc"
arch="all"
license="LGPL"
-subpackages="$pkgname-dev gvncviewer $pkgname-lang py-$pkgname:py $pkgname-doc"
-makedepends="gnutls-dev gtk+-dev libiconv-dev gettext-dev intltool expat-dev
+depends_dev="gtk+3.0-dev gnutls-dev glib-dev"
+makedepends="$depends_dev libiconv-dev gettext-dev intltool expat-dev
libgcrypt-dev libgpg-error-dev cyrus-sasl-dev perl-text-csv
- gobject-introspection-dev python-dev py-gtk-dev py-gobject-dev"
-depends_dev="gtk+-dev gnutls-dev"
+ gobject-introspection-dev vala"
source="http://ftp.gnome.org/pub/gnome/sources/$pkgname/${pkgver%.*}/$pkgname-$pkgver.tar.xz"
-build ()
-{
+subpackages="$pkgname-dev gvncviewer $pkgname-lang $pkgname-doc"
+build () {
cd "$srcdir"/$pkgname-$pkgver
./configure --prefix=/usr \
- --with-python \
--with-examples \
--enable-introspection \
+ --with-gtk=3.0 \
--disable-static || return 1
make || return 1
}
@@ -27,8 +26,7 @@ build ()
package() {
cd "$srcdir"/$pkgname-$pkgver
make -j1 DESTDIR="$pkgdir" install || return 1
- rm "$pkgdir"/usr/lib/*.la \
- "$pkgdir"/usr/lib/python*/site-packages/*.la
+ rm "$pkgdir"/usr/lib/*.la
}
gvncviewer() {
@@ -37,12 +35,6 @@ gvncviewer() {
mv "$pkgdir"/usr/bin "$subpkgdir"/usr/
}
-py() {
- pkgdesc="Python binding for gtk-vnc"
- mkdir -p "$subpkgdir"/usr/lib
- mv "$pkgdir"/usr/lib/python* "$subpkgdir"/usr/lib/
-}
-
md5sums="591f5c0efff931336cba5b56e0c64e0d gtk-vnc-0.5.2.tar.xz"
sha256sums="b51bda7edebb82ab142c292bd1b1493406bc8225a5c834d854bbafef9e9a471f gtk-vnc-0.5.2.tar.xz"
sha512sums="e58a0bbb4c5d1802d51936d5869ccad55cd405f6939f49445e224863866a33173e47e055d88f50e60b3f864a7e393faf0c78a219a08ee8a8c1fc8fe108f9824a gtk-vnc-0.5.2.tar.xz"